Play the world's courses at iGolf!

The iGolf indoor golf centre features a new Protee golf simulator with access to some the world's finest golf courses. Have you always wanted to play the 1st, 17th and 18th at St. Andrew's? Maybe the 7th and 18th at Pebble Beach or are you desperate to play Augusta National? It's all possible at iGolf! 

The Protee simulator enables you to play any course or any combination of holes, take part in nearest the pin and longest drive competitions, head to the range to hone your skills and deliver feedback on every shot you take. The feedback data includes distance, carry, swing path, club head position at impact, launch angle and much much more!

The centre is heated, a supply of hot and cold refreshments is available, or if you prefer bring your own and order in pizza etc.

iGolf caters for the single player, two, three and fourballs, group bookings and corporate events.

Guide Prices

Pricing:
Price per hour £25.00 for one player. Each additional player charged at £5.00 per hour.
